Usually, we break a cannabis plant&#8217;s profile down into fruity, floral, earthy and gassy; however, this is a very basic analysis. Below is a list of the most commonly found terpenes in cannabis and their effects.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Myrcene &#8211; Associated with a musky and earthy aroma and a deeply relaxing effect<\/li>\n<li>Limonene &#8211; A sharp citrus aroma that produces an upbeat and elevated mindset<\/li>\n<li>Pinene &#8211; Pine tree and woody aroma that enhances focus and creates clarity<\/li>\n<li>Caryophyllene &#8211; Spicy, musky and peppery, known for its therapeutic and pain relief<\/li>\n<li>Linalool &#8211; Floral and bright aroma, associated with a calming anti-anxiety effect<\/li>\n<li>Terpinolene &#8211; Fresh and herbal scent, produces an uplifting but sedative effect<\/li>\n<li>Humulene &#8211; Has a woody and hop aroma, and can help with stress and migraines<\/li>\n<li>Ocimene &#8211; Herbal and woody, with sweet overtones. Uplifting and energising<\/li>\n<li>Camphene &#8211; Earth and herbal aroma with a powerful antioxidant effect<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<h2>Cannabis Terpenes Explained: Why Terpenes in Weed Matter<\/h2>\n<p>The reason why terpenes are so essential when growing cannabis is that they are primarily responsible for producing the unique aroma and flavour profile of cannabis. This is the same terpene found in mangoes, lemongrass, and hops, and is strongly associated with the relaxing, sleepy, and sedating effects after consuming a joint. The aroma of myrcene can be described as earthy, musky, herbal and spicy. The flavour profile of myrcene is citrus, clove and balsam with mildly sweet overtones.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Myrcene has a deeply relaxing and stress-relieving effect<\/li>\n<li>It can help with pain relief and anti-inflammatory properties<\/li>\n<li>Indica cannabis plants typically have high levels of myrcene<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<h2>Caryophyllene Terpene: Unique Properties and Caryophyllene Terpene Effects<\/h2>\n<p>Caryophyllene has a distinctive woody, spicy, musky and peppery aroma, with hints of fuel, gas and cinnamon. It is one of the terpenes that give plants an old-school, earthy profile. The flavour of caryophyllene is described as woody, spicy and sharp.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>This terpene has strong anti-inflammatory properties<\/li>\n<li>Also associated with pain relief<\/li>\n<li>Girl Scout Cookies and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.msnlseeds.com\/gorilla-glue-feminized-seeds\">GG#4<\/a> are caryophyllene dominant<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<h2>Linalool Terpene Effects: Floral Notes and Potential Benefits<\/h2>\n<p>Found in lavender and mint, linalool is a strong, sharp, floral terpene. The aroma of linalool is described as spicy, citrusy, and floral, with sweet lavender tones. Cannabis that contains high levels of linalool often has a balanced flavour profile that is sweet, herbal, and floral.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Linalool is known for having anti-anxiety and calming properties<\/li>\n<li>A heavy and sedative effect that can cause tiredness and couch lock<\/li>\n<li>Grandaddy Purple and Zkittles have tested for high levels of linalool<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<h2>How Terpenes and Cannabinoids Work Together In Harmony<\/h2>\n<p>Even though we associate cannabinoids with the reason why we experience a cerebral or physical body effect, terpenes are just as important and responsible. Based on my experience, implementing the following organic inputs into your cannabis crops significantly enhances flavour, aroma, plant health and vitality as well as the soil food web.<\/p>\n<p>\u00a0<\/p>\n<h3>Aerated Organic Compost Teas<\/h3>\n<p>All you need to make aerated tea is an air stone, an air pump, a bucket, and a chlorine-free water source. You will start by filling the bucket with pH-adjusted water and allowing worm castings or freshly harvested compost to brew in a micron mesh bag. The tea must be aerated for 24 hours to promote the highest possible microbial and fungal count.<\/p>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-1c91970 e-con-full e-flex e-con e-child\" data-id=\"1c91970\" data-element_type=\"container\" data-e-type=\"container\">\n\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-c2f4dee e-con-full e-flex e-con e-child\" data-id=\"c2f4dee\" data-element_type=\"container\" data-e-type=\"container\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-6fd2c47 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"6fd2c47\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<h3>Worm Castings<\/h3>\n<p>Worms are a grower&#8217;s best friend, as they not only produce nutrient-rich, slow-release foods teeming with millions of beneficial bacteria but also aerate the soil as they crawl around.
